You might have heard of Maurice Béjart, a choreographer and ballet director who died last week at the age of 80.

What you might not have heard of is that 10 years ago he created Le Presbytère (Ballet or Life), a ballet to the music of Queen and Mozart, dedicated to those who had died young, especially from Aids. It is a synthesis of different arts – music, dance, and fashion performance and was performed for the first time in January 1997 with Gianni Versace creating the costumes for it.
